Remeber the legendary Second Reality Demo by Future Crew?

No, I wasn't familiar with it and had to look it up on Wikipedia first. But now I'm all the more amazed 
For anyone else who doesn't know: no, it's not a demo for an early 3D program, but a Coder demo. That means everything you see is generated virtually. For 1993, it was quite an amazing thing, considering that a 486th was recommended for its execution (as mentioned, it is ONLY software). The related article on Wikipedia is recommended.

I'm not familiar with that one. I wasn't using a PC in those days. I was into the demo scene but it was first of all on the C64 and then the Amiga. The demo scene was especially vibrant on the Amiga cause the hardware capabilities at that time were state of the art.
I had a mate who had a dial-up modem used to copy the demos to floppy disk for me
